BETBY GROWS LATAM PRESENCE WITH JUEGAENLINEA DEAL
BETBY, the innovative sportsbook supplier, has significantly grown its reach in Latin America, partnering with Juegaenlinea in a deal that will see it roll out its complete solution.
Juegaenlinea customers in Chile, Ecuador, Peru and Venezuela will now have access to the provider’s complete end-to-end product, which offers markets on over 600,000 live events a year, across a range of sports.
The operator will be using BETBY’s latest sportsbook layout, which gives the smoothest user experience to date, while also giving complete customisation abilities to players, through a series of widgets and pins that can enhance any betting experience.
BETBY will also be supplying its thrilling collection of AI-led esports products, Betby.Games. With titles covering football, basketball, Rocket League, tennis and more, the provider’s innovative range adds a valuable vertical for all sportsbook partners.
The agreement marks the latest commercial expansion for BETBY in 2021, following integrations with Betmaster and Starfish Media, among others, as it looks to further expand its global presence.

How BETBY plans to make an impact in LatAm
BETBY is firmly focused on making a splash in Latin America and recently attended the inaugural SBC Latinoamérica Summit. COO Eva Berkova talks about the key takeaways and plans for the region in 2024.
From a BETBY perspective, what are some of your key takeaways from the SBC Latinoamerica Summit?
After visiting this exhibition, it has become even more evident to us that Latin America rightly deserves to be a key focus for us, and we look forward to making a concerted effort to capitalise on the excitement this market brings. We already have several big partners here, but the region is very dynamic, and we are firmly convinced that we are going the right way, putting LatAm as one of our key focuses.
At the exhibition we saw genuine interest in our product from delegates who know the workings and nuances of the LatAm landscape, and such are the opportunities in Latin America, we do not want to veer away from the territory and enhance our product portfolio to its passionate sports betting audiences.
With a wide range of operators, affiliates, regulators, and many other industry delegates in attendance, were there any key learnings that will influence your decision making for planning a long-term strategy for any expansion into the region?
For some time now we have been planning to introduce BETBY into the local market with a physical presence, and showcase the power and ingenuity of our products. After visiting the exhibition, our opinion was validated, personal connections and everyday communication are the cultural norm in this region, which really appeals to our company, and not only in business terms.
Constant communication is a key characteristic of the people of this region. Visiting the exhibition reaffirmed our belief that in order to strengthen BETBY’s position here, we need to expand our physical presence in the form of our own LatAm office with a Spanish-speaking team.
The untapped potential of the Latin America market is well-documented, what is it about the market that excites BETBY most?
The LatAm market appeals to us because of its breadth and appetite for sports. In this market, there is also a huge opportunity to promote esports. Esports in LatAm is still a niche that is not very saturated with content and offers, as there is a sustained promotion of traditional sports that are hugely loved in the region like basketball, baseball, and soccer.
The potential of the market is truly enormous, without exaggeration. With our mentality and extensive sportsbook solution, BETBY’s products and ethos weave perfectly into the local fabric – both in terms of our company values and business approach.
How do you go about setting yourself apart from other competitors who are targeting the LatAm region?
For much of the LatAm population, sport is their life, exuding passion and love for their favourite teams and individuals. Many championships and tournaments are held here on a regular basis, which are of interest to local bettors. As BETBY has its own trading department, we can offer odds and markets for these local tournaments. This is one of our many unique selling points that sets our company apart.
Esports in LatAm is becoming increasingly popular, how will your Betby.Games offering cater capitalise on this growth?
The role of esports in LatAm is not that big yet, but it certainly has the potential to be. FIFA and Valorant are generally popular here, and BETBY offers three types of FIFA content in addition to a large esports package, which also includes Valorant.
But the greatest interest is in Betby.Games – BETBY’s own product. An AI-powered sports feed with game mechanics that excludes human interference on the outrights, Betby.Games offers fully localised and customisable leagues and tournaments that includes the Libertadores Cup and South American Cup, which are of particular interest to local bettors.

BETBY expands eSports presence in Latin America with Aposta Ganha deal
BETBY, the innovative sportsbook supplier, has partnered with Brazilian brand Aposta Ganha to provide it with its growing Betby.Games range of content.
The operator’s customers will soon be able to enjoy leading titles from the eSports portfolio, including Cricket, NBA 2K, Rocket League, and eFighting, as well as a hugely popular football title.
The Betby.Games range offers more than 100,000 live events per month, across more than 250 betting markets. It can be seamlessly integrated into any sportsbook platform, either as a standalone product, or as part of a broader ecosystem.
BETBY’s latest partnership marks further expansion across the globe for the provider, which has had a particular focus on Latin America in recent months.
